t.rast3d.mapcalc
Performs r3.mapcalc expressions on maps of sampled space time 3D raster datasets.
t.rast3d.mapcalc [-ns] inputs=name [,name,...] expression=string [method=name [,name,...]] output=name basename=string [nprocs=integer] [--overwrite] [--verbose] [--quiet] [--qq] [--ui]

Parameters
inputs=name [,name,...] [required]
Name of the input space time raster3d datasets
expression=string [required]
r3.mapcalc expression applied to each time step of the sampled data
method=name [,name,...]
The method to be used for sampling the input dataset
Allowed values: start, during, overlap, contain, equal, follows, precedes
Default: during,overlap,contain,equal
output=name [required]
Name of the output space time raster3d dataset
basename=string [required]
Basename of the new generated output maps
A numerical suffix separated by an underscore will be attached to create a unique identifier
nprocs=integer
Number of r3.mapcalc processes to run in parallel
Default: 1
-n
Register Null maps
-s
Check the spatial topology of temporally related maps and process only spatially related maps
--overwrite
Allow output files to overwrite existing files
--help
Print usage summary
--verbose
Verbose module output
--quiet
Quiet module output
--qq
Very quiet module output
--ui
Force launching GUI dialog

DESCRIPTION
t.rast3d.mapcalc provides exact the same functionality as t.rast.mapcalc, but for space time 3D raster datasets. Please refer to t.rast.mapcalc for documentation.
It is a simple wrapper for r3.mapcalc enhanced with temporal functions.
